Kansas City CARE SEC³UREs Their Environment With IntelliCentricsFLOWER MOUND, Texas, Oct. 8, 2015 /PRNewswire/ -- IntelliCentrics, Inc. has been chosen by Kansas City CARE Clinic (KC CARE) to improve quality patient care by providing a safe and SEC³URE environment. This move uniquely aligns the two entities given KC CARE's mission is to provide quality care to the uninsured and underinsured in the Kansas City community. KC CARE Clinic promotes health and wellness by providing quality care, access, research, and education to the people of Kansas City. KC CARE accomplishes this objective with a full-time staff of only 105 and over 1,200 volunteers. One of the largest community health clinics in the country, the clinic is funded largely through donations, grants, special events, United Way, and contributed goods and services.
